UAE Ministry of Economy warns suppliers against hiking prices
The UAE's Ministry of Economy , MoE, warned suppliers Sunday against hiking of commodities and services prices by suppliers and urged consumers in the UAE to resort to the Ministry's and other relevant authorities' hotlines in case of any violation by suppliers in Dubai, said MoE in a press release.The warning came at a meeting at the Ministry's premises in Dubai where Director of the Ministry's Consumer Protection Unit Dr. Hashim Al Nuaimi, and representatives of Dubai's Department of Economic Development and Dubai's Municipality discussed ways to address the issue."We agreed on having more coordination among our offices as well as on strictly monitoring shops and other sectors to prevent suppliers from hiking prices of commodities and services on claims of the increasing employee's salaries", said Al-Nuaimi."Dubai's Department of Economic Development and Dubai's Municipality will provide the Consumer Protection Unit with reports about actions taken against any violator of the rules", he added.The Ministry's said it dedicated the following hotlines for reporting violations:
- -The Ministry Of Economy's Consumer Protection Unit : 600522225.
- -Dubai's Department of Economic Development: 04-2020220.
- -Dubai's Municipality Emergency: 04-2232323.
- -Dubai's Municipality : 800900.
